Project Officer

On-going contract Inside IR 35

Bristol

About the role

Project Officers to a 12-month task and finish group that will provide professional environmental advice and technical guidance to the City Region Sustainable Transport Settlement (CRSTS) programme, working across the Environment and Infrastructure Directorates.

Responsibilities

  • Contribute to the delivery of the work programme and provide high quality outputs by the agreed deadlines.
  • Provide environmental requirements for legal, grant agreement, policy, project and technical documents.
  • Provide technical expertise for CRSTS projects.
  • Set out clear requirements for the business case development stages, grant agreements (where applicable), contracts, health and safety, budgeting, and forecasting.
  • Provide technical expertise for the assessment and appraisal of CRSTS projects in respect to meeting their environmental requirements.
  • Inform the approach for evaluating, monitoring, and auditing CRSTS projects in relation to their environmental requirements.
  • Apply a continuous improvement approach, including capturing lessons learned.
  • Proactively engage and communicate with CRSTS project managers, internal and external stakeholders.
  • Escalate project risks, as and when required, to project manager.
  • Contribute to a positive team culture with a passion for improving environmental outcomes of infrastructure projects.
  • Manage budgets for projects if required, keep track of costs of environmental work in their subject area.
  • Create, manage, and update project documentation, including timelines, risk registers, etc., and ensure project delivery to tight deadlines.
  • Provide written and verbal regular updates to their line manager and support briefings for senior leaders as required.

Knowledge

  • Educated to degree level or with equivalent work experience.
  • Qualification in an environment subject.
  • Knowledge of the wider climate and nature emergencies and national, regional, and local responses to it.
